O's activate Lindstrom, option Tolleson
Jun 27, 2012 - 9:03 PM Baltimore, MD (Sports Network) - The Baltimore Orioles activated right-hander Matt Lindstrom from the 15-day disabled list Wednesday and optioned infielder Steve Tolleson to Triple-A Norfolk.Lindstrom had been on the disabled list since May 11 with a right middle finger injury. He had a 1.29 earned run average in 13 appearances before that and made four rehab appearances, one each with Gulf Coast and Double-A Bowie.
Tolleson batted .220 with two homers and six runs batted in over 17 games.
